About the Opportunity 

Reporting to Executive Vice President Program Development, the Clinton Foundation seeks an experienced and creative development professional with a proven track record working in a fast-paced environment in corporate, non-profit, and/or political fundraising. This individual will identify, research, profile individual and foundation prospects; and will be responsible for creating internal strategy memos framing solicitation approach 

Core Responsibilities  

Prospect Research and Qualification 

  • Write and produce reports on prospects based on an in-depth analysis of data collected via research, and by gathering information from existing Foundation resources.   
  • Establish requisite processes, in collaboration with program and Development colleagues, to identify and qualify prospective funders. 
  • Offer guidance on donor strategy and identification of prospects, including gift capacity and inclination towards specific Foundation programs or subject matters. 
  • Research and identify new potential donors. 

Prospect Management and Process Optimization 

  • Maintain and update list of prospects based on internal feedback and external information. 
  • Support management of the air table database, creating and importing new records; responsible for accuracy of data; oversee prospect management; and produce queries and reports.   
  • Develop and manage systems and processes for portfolio optimization that align with development priorities.

About the Clinton Foundation 

Building on a lifetime of public service, President Clinton established the Clinton Foundation on the simple belief that everyone deserves a chance to succeed, everyone has a responsibility to act, and we all do better when we work together. For nearly two decades, that premise has energized the work of the Foundation in overcoming complex challenges and improving the lives of people across the United States and around the world. 

As an operating foundation, we work on issues directly or with strategic partners from the business, government, and nonprofit sectors to create economic opportunity, improve public health, and inspire civic engagement and service. Our programs are designed to make a real difference today while serving as proven models for tomorrow. The goal of every effort is to use available resources to get better results faster – at the lowest possible cost.
